(Philadelphia, PA) — Chartwell Law is pleased to announce that Sara Kennedy joined the firm on July 7 as its new Chief Human Resources Officer (CHRO). In this role, she will serve as a key member of the firm’s executive leadership team.

With deep experience leading human capital strategies across the healthcare, finance, and manufacturing industries, Kennedy brings a dynamic and people-centered approach to human resources that aligns with Chartwell’s commitment to growth, innovation, and culture.

“Sara’s vision, experience, and inclusive leadership style make her an ideal fit for Chartwell as we continue building a workplace where all individuals feel valued, supported, and empowered to grow and succeed.” said Dana Bennett, Chartwell’s Chief Administrative Officer. “We are thrilled to welcome her to our leadership team.”

Kennedy’s background outside the legal industry was one of the key qualities that made her an especially appealing candidate for Chartwell. Her diverse industry experience brings fresh perspectives, creative problem-solving, and innovative strategies to the firm—qualities that are increasingly essential as the industry evolves.

Prior to joining Chartwell, Kennedy served as Director of HR Operations at Penn State Health’s Milton S. Hershey Medical Center, where she supported over 10,000 employees across a multi-billion dollar healthcare enterprise. She also held senior leadership roles at Members 1st Federal Credit Union, where she played a pivotal role in transforming performance management systems, launching inclusive leadership training programs, and guiding the organization through a period of rapid growth and cultural evolution.

Known for her collaborative and transparent leadership style, Kennedy describes herself as an “HR nerd” with a deep passion for creating cultures where every individual feels a sense of belonging. As CHRO, Kennedy will oversee all aspects of Chartwell’s human resources strategy, including talent acquisition and retention, employee relations, performance management, and compensation and benefits. She will also join the leadership group overseeing the firm’s diversity and inclusion initiatives, and the firm’s ongoing Mansfield Rule certification efforts. Furthermore, she will serve as a strategic advisor on organizational design, leadership development, and long-term workforce planning to help Chartwell meet the evolving needs of its people and clients.
